[Author Prev][Author Next][Thread Prev][Thread Next][Author Index][Thread Index]

Re: [tor-bugs] #2163 [Vidalia]: Disable menubar icon in OS X



#2163: Disable menubar icon in OS X
---------------------------------+------------------------------------------
 Reporter:  jabes                |          Owner:  chiiph        
     Type:  enhancement          |         Status:  assigned      
 Priority:  normal               |      Milestone:                
Component:  Vidalia              |        Version:  Vidalia 0.2.10
 Keywords:  os x, menubar, icon  |         Parent:                
   Points:                       |   Actualpoints:                
---------------------------------+------------------------------------------

Comment(by jrklein):

 edmanm:

 Thank you. Please bear with me since I'm a newcomer. I really appreciate
 this type of feedback!

 1) The .plist template is already being populated by CMAKE and placed in
 the correct folder (Vidalia.app/Contents/Info.plist).  This was happening
 before I came along.  I just specified a custom file so that I could add
 the LSUIElement setting required by this patch.  Please confirm if
 something should be done differently here?

 2) This makes sense.  After investigating names for #3, I'll likely rename
 "Dock" to "TaskbarOnly" and "Tray" to "TrayOnly" while defining these
 constants.  Open to other name suggestions.

 3) I like your suggestion much better.  I'll go with the following names,
 unless I shouldn't abbreviate the constant name either?

 SETTING_ICON_DISPLAY_PREF    "IconDisplayPreference"

 I'll submit an updated patch in the next day or two.  Thanks again!

-- 
Ticket URL: <https://trac.torproject.org/projects/tor/ticket/2163#comment:5>
Tor Bug Tracker & Wiki <https://trac.torproject.org/>
The Tor Project: anonymity online
_______________________________________________
tor-bugs mailing list
tor-bugs@xxxxxxxxxxxxxxxxxxxx
https://lists.torproject.org/cgi-bin/mailman/listinfo/tor-bugs